Intermediate sprints in the Vuelta a España

Choose a different year:

In 1958, intermediate sprints were introduced in the Vuelta. Somewhere in the middle of a stage (excluding time trials), there was a sprint: the first riders to arrive at this sprint would get points for a new classification. Results for this classification per stage are shown below.

In some years, there were also points earned for the points classification, in other years the winner got a point for the combination classification, and in other years a time bonus for the general classification.
